Understanding The Cost Of Pet Cremation Equipment

When it comes to saying goodbye to a beloved pet, many pet owners choose cremation as a way to honor their furry friend As the demand for pet cremation services continues to rise, more businesses are investing in pet cremation equipment However, the cost of this equipment can vary significantly depending on the size and features of the unit.

The cost of pet cremation equipment can range from a few thousand dollars to tens of thousands of dollars, depending on the size and capabilities of the unit The most basic pet cremation equipment consists of a cremation chamber, a secondary chamber for emissions control, and a control panel for operating the unit These basic units typically cost between $5,000 and $10,000, making them a relatively affordable option for businesses looking to expand their services.

For businesses that are looking to cater to a larger volume of clients or offer additional services, there are more advanced pet cremation units available These units can cost anywhere from $10,000 to $30,000 or more, depending on their size and capabilities Some advanced pet cremation units may include features such as automated loading and ash removal systems, advanced emissions control technology, and digital control panels for easy operation.

In addition to the cost of the equipment itself, businesses also need to consider the cost of installation and ongoing maintenance The installation of pet cremation equipment can be a complex process that requires a professional technician to ensure that the unit is set up correctly and safely Depending on the size and complexity of the unit, installation costs can range from a few thousand dollars to tens of thousands of dollars.
